Recipe - Chocolate Almond Treats

Categories: None, Chocolate Almond Treats
Ingredients:

One half cup Butter or margarine; (not
spread)
1 cup Packed lightbrown sugar
2 tablespoon Light corn syrup
1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
3 cup Kellogg's Cocoa Krispies
1 cup Milk chocolate chips
Three fourths cup Sliced; unblanched almonds

Heat oven to 350 degrees. Line an 8in. square baking pan with heavy duty
foil, folding over edges of pan. Put butter in pan; melt in oven. Add brown
sugar, corn syrup and vanilla; stir to mix. Add cereal and stir with a
spoon, then mix with fingers until thoroughly coated. Place waxed paper on
top and press down gently but firmly. Bake 25 min. until entire surface is
bubbly. Sprinkle chocolate chips and let stand 5 min. for chips to soften.
Spread chips, then sprinkle with almonds, pressing gently into chocolate.
Let cool until just warm, then refrigerate at least 1 hour or overnight
before cutting. Usinf foil as a lifter, remove from pan and, without
inverting (almonds will fall off), peel off foil. Cut into bars. store in
refrigerator. Makes 24. Per bar: 135 cal, 1 g pro,17 g car, 7 g fat, 10 mg
chol with butter, 0 mg chol with margarine, 73 mg sod. Exchanges: 1/4
starch, Three fourths other car, 1 One half fat.
